Page 19 text:

MR. ROLLIN B. CHILD. President District 274 School Board: “If nothing else students learn responsibility and develop the ability to program their own time. This I think is important whether they go on to college or not. It's particularly important for students going to college because then immediately they're in a situation requiring personal responsibility, and the same thing is true throughout life. MR. D. ECKBERG. Chairman Social Studies Department: More individualized instruction—that's what we're striving for. One of the means to get there is through behavioral objectives by which the student is told exactly what he must do. Then he may go about learning it in many ways. Students might be encouraged to go on to exceed the teacher's objectives. and from there the sky could be the limit. MR. D. R. COPPINS. Principal: The belief is of course that we're moving from the traditional type of instruction that has been teacher-dominated to one in which the students benefit by self-expression, study subjects in depth on their own initiative, and develop their own responsibility ... I think it's also important to stress that Modular Scheduling is a process of development and that that process is a continuing one. KRIS HENNINGSGARD. Senior: I think the problems with Modular Scheduling came because everyone was sort of thrown into the system. When we become more accustomed to it. a lot of the problems will be solved. Students will be able to take care of their time: teachers will be able to move faster: there'll be less vandalism.
